+\begin{abstract}
+\noindent
+\module{wsgiref} is a reference implementation of the WSGI specification
+that can be used to add WSGI support to a web server or framework. It also
+contains some useful utilities for writing applications or middleware that
+provide or implement WSGI.
+\end{abstract}
